Burger Chain Unveils Donut Burger With a Sunny Side Up Egg

Slaters 50/50 Sunny Side Donut Burger

From the same guys that brought you the 100% Bacon Burger and one of the spiciest burger concoctions we’ve ever tasted,  Southern California’s Slater’s 50/50 has just release its Sunny Side Donut Burger just in time for the second glorious week of NFL Football.

The burger includes their traditional half beef, half bacon patty, American Cheese, a sunny-side-up-egg sandwiched between two giant glazed donuts for $9.95. The burger will be served during the breakfast hours of 9 AM – 12 PM on football weekends. Might just have to grab one as I watch my stacked NFL fantasy team continue to underperform.
